分布式和并行的区别?

时间:01-20人气:28作者:雨落心尘

分布式和并行都是处理任务的高效方式,但侧重点不同。分布式系统将任务分散到多台计算机上协作完成,强调资源共享和容错能力;并行系统则是在同一台计算机内通过多个处理器同时执行任务,追求计算速度的提升。

区别

分布式:多台独立计算机通过网络连接,共同完成一个大型任务。每台计算机处理部分数据,结果汇总后输出。优点是扩展性强,单台计算机故障不影响整体系统。常见应用包括云计算和大数据处理,比如一个电商平台将订单分配到不同服务器处理。

并行:同一台计算机内多个处理器同时运行,共享内存和资源。任务被拆分成小片段,处理器同步执行。优点是速度快,适合计算密集型任务。比如视频剪辑软件同时渲染多个画面片段,缩短制作时间。

注意:本站部分文字内容、图片由网友投稿,如侵权请联系删除,联系邮箱:happy56812@qq.com

相关文章
本类推荐
本类排行